Key events ahead - Westpac
FXStreet (Guatemala) - Sean Callow, analyst at Westpac Banking Corporation explained the key events ahead.
Key Quotes:
"The Asia calendar is second tier, with only China Jun industrial profits and Thai Jun trade but noted the sessions."
"German Jul IFO business climate is expected to dip slightly from 107.4 to 107.2. Consensus is for both sub-indices to slip slightly. US Jun total durable goods orders should recover from -1.8%m/m to 3.2% as transport orders bounce back from their Apr/May slump. Excluding transport, the median forecast is for a 0.5% rise from flat. The Jul Dallas Fed manufacturing index will give us another update on the impact of oil prices. Markets expect it to continue to bounce from May’s multi year lows.
